Member Care Support for Overnight (100% Remote)

Virtual

The Member Support Agent will leverage insights from sensor data, wellness surveys, and other sources of relevant information to drive both proactive and reactive customer communications. In this role you will form relationships with our customers to help them achieve wellness and support while living independently at home.

If you are a person who enjoys working with seniors and caregivers, passionate about pushing the boundaries of consumer technologies in the home environment then we would love to speak with you!

This role reports to the Care Agent Supervisor and will be based virtually across the United States.

Work hours are: 11pm-8amPST and require working both Saturdays and Sundays

What you will do:

  • Review and apply information derived from customer profiles in the CRM, wellness dashboards and other sources as the basis for delivering informed customer communications to drive ongoing independence, quality of life and peace of mind for seniors and caregivers.
  • Analyze situations quickly and make sound decisions in emergency and routine situations.
  • Communicate necessary information to 911 services per ClearWellness workflows.
  • Establish a trusted relationship with the senior and their caregivers.
  • Inbound/Outbound telephone communication, managing associated documentation as well as email, text and/or chat services with seniors and caregivers.
  • Provide input on improvement opportunities for products, processes, and procedures.
  • Meet weekly/monthly metrics related to service level, performance, and customer satisfaction.
    • Other duties will include general account maintenance such as updating customer records, features, and usage questions while ensuring satisfaction with our service, and resource research for members/caregivers.
